DTC P0010 Camshaft Position "A" Actuator Circuit (Bank 1) |
DESCRIPTION
- HINT:
- This DTC relates to the oil control valve.
The Variable Valve Timing (VVT) system includes the ECM, intake camshaft timing oil control valve assembly and VVT controller. The ECM sends a target duty cycle control signal to the intake camshaft timing oil control valve assembly. This control signal regulates the oil pressure applied to the VVT controller. Camshaft timing control is performed according to engine operating conditions such as the intake air volume, throttle valve position and engine coolant temperature. The ECM controls the intake camshaft timing oil control valve assembly based on the signals transmitted by several sensors. The VVT controller regulates the intake camshaft angle using oil pressure through the intake camshaft timing oil control valve assembly. As a result, the relative positions of the camshaft and crankshaft are optimized, the engine torque and fuel economy improve, and the exhaust emissions decrease under overall driving conditions. The ECM detects the actual intake valve timing using signals from the camshaft and crankshaft position sensors, and performs feedback control. This is how the target intake valve timing is verified by the ECM.
DTC No.
| DTC Detection Condition
| Trouble Area
|
P0010
| An open or short in the camshaft timing oil control valve for the intake camshaft circuit (1 trip detection logic).
| - Open or short in camshaft timing oil control valve circuit for intake camshaft
- Camshaft timing oil control valve for intake camshaft
- ECM
|

INSPECTION PROCEDURE
- HINT:
- Read freeze frame data using the intelligent tester. The ECM records vehicle and driving condition information as freeze frame data the moment a DTC is stored. When troubleshooting, freeze frame data can help determine if the vehicle was moving or stationary, if the engine was warmed up or not, if the air fuel ratio was lean or rich, and other data from the time the malfunction occurred.
1.PERFORM ACTIVE TEST USING INTELLIGENT TESTER (OPERATE CAMSHAFT TIMING OIL CONTROL VALVE) |
Connect the intelligent tester to the DLC3.
Start the engine and turn the tester on.
Enter the following menus: Powertrain / Engine and ECT / Active Test / Control the VVT System (Bank 1).
Check the engine speed when the oil control valve is operated using the intelligent tester when the engine coolant temperature is 50°C (122°F) or less.
- HINT:
- When performing the Active Test, make sure the air conditioning is on.
- Make sure the engine coolant temperature when the engine is started is 30°C (86°F) or less.
- OK:
Tester Operation
| Specified Condition
|
Oil control valve OFF
| Normal engine speed
|
Oil control valve ON
| Engine idles roughly or stalls (Soon after oil control valve switched from OFF to ON)
|
2.INSPECT CAMSHAFT TIMING OIL CONTROL VALVE ASSEMBLY |
Remove the camshaft timing oil control valve assembly.
Measure the resistance according to the value(s) in the table below.
- Standard Resistance:
Tester Connection
| Condition
| Specified Condition
|
1 - 2
| 20°C (68°F)
| 6.9 to 7.9 Ω
|
Text in Illustration*1
| Component without harness connected (Camshaft Timing Oil Control Valve)
|
Apply positive (+) battery voltage to terminal 1 and negative (-) battery voltage to terminal 2. Check the valve operation.
- OK:
- Valve moves quickly.
Reinstall the camshaft timing oil control valve assembly.
3.CHECK HARNESS AND CONNECTOR (CAMSHAFT TIMING OIL CONTROL VALVE ASSEMBLY - ECM) |
Disconnect the camshaft timing oil control valve assembly connector.
Disconnect the ECM connector.
Measure the resistance according to the value(s) in the table below.
- Standard Resistance (Check for Open):
Tester Connection
| Condition
| Specified Condition
|
B116-1 - B32-74 (OC1+)
| Always
| Below 1 Ω
|
B116-2 - B32-96 (OC1-)
| Always
| Below 1 Ω
|
- Standard Resistance (Check for Short):
Tester Connection
| Condition
| Specified Condition
|
B116-1 or B32-74 (OC1+) - Body ground
| Always
| 10 kΩ or higher
|
B116-2 or B32-96 (OC1-) - Body ground
| Always
| 10 kΩ or higher
|
